I ordered 6 carnitas tacos during happy hour. The bill was about $8 cheaper ordering during happy hour. The tacos are beautifully packaged. The containers make it so much better to receive your order in one piece, rather than the fillings spilled out all over the place. The tacos are garnished with the traditional diced white onion and cilantro. They come with pickled vegetables (onion, carrot, jalapeño) and salsa verde, all on the side. The flavor of the carnitas are out of this world. Absolutely exceptional. Adding some of the pickled veg and salsa verde sets it off even more. The flavors bounce on your tongue. I would definitely order from this place again. The price is unbeatable, and the quality and quantity of the food is amazing. If I could change one thing, it would be to make the salsa verde a little more spicy. Overall, I give it a 94/100. A.

It saddens me to write this review. Flores has always been an institution in my mind, with food and drink a level above the rest. Living in the neighborhood, I’d grown to love their to-go burrito. It was a high quality, sizable burrito on the Marina’s best tortilla. It even included a scoop of chips and salsa. The burrito was capable of turning a less than average week.
Flores, notably the burrito, was one of the things I told newcomers to the neighborhood about and they too grew fond of Flores. The burrito reminded me of Flores and kept visiting on the weekends with friends.
And then, in instant, the burrito fell apart. There are three degradations to the burrito that make it such that I can’t order it anymore:
1. It’s roughly half its old size. We could maybe live with this in the name of health.
2. It no longer comes with chips and salsa. We could maybe live with this given the chips have always felt like a nice complimentary item.
3. It includes noticeably lower quality of meat. This is one is hard to swallow.
In combination, these three changes make the burrito not worth ordering. Furthermore, the demise of the burrito has turned the tide on my positive associations with Flores. I’d ask that Flores management take this review seriously and reflects on the change.
